Ticket: Crashfall ingest failing on staging

New folks, please read carefully. The Pebblekit mobile app's crash reports aren't reaching the symbolication queue because staging's env file was copied without its upload credential. Symptoms: 401s in the collector logs every five minutes. To fix, add the missing line to the env file, exactly as follows.

secret setting of fafop-tagep: VAULT_KEY29=6a815d21e2d77cc25ef1802d73ee6

Q: How does the Grainwise telemetry gateway get data off the combines? A: Each machine runs a small agent that buffers readings locally and syncs over cellular when it has signal — so gaps in the dashboard usually just mean a tractor's in a dead zone, not an outage. Don't page anyone until a unit is dark for 6+ hours. Setup steps, buffer limits, and the escalation checklist all live on our onboarding page.

runbook for kajof-bahif: https://sentry.ferranet.local/merge_requests/repo/projects/view/81769af030f7d6d2

Subject: Consent Banner Handover

Hi team,

The Marigold consent banner is now live in all regions. Dismissal state syncs within five minutes; if users report a reappearing banner, clear their preference cache first. Escalations go to the Thistledown rollout channel. Release bundles are signed, and you should verify them with this key.

deploy key for kajof-fajop: bky6_gDHw9Q

Hey — quick handover before I'm off. The Brindlewood partner SFTP drop has been flaky since Tuesday: their uploads land in /incoming/brindle but the mover script sometimes grabs half-written files. I added a 5-minute age check as a stopgap, so don't panic if ingestion lags a bit. If files stop arriving entirely, the partner usually needs a nudge on their end. Full notes are in the Fennelworks runbook. For escalation, the person responsible is named below.

account owner for bawip-tahag: Raleth Quenok